Port Hope Turns Into Bridgeport for Hardy Boys Series

In entertainment, Local

Filming for “The Hardy Boys” has shut down Walton and Queen Streets in Port Hope until Friday evening.

The popular production starting Rohan Campbell as Frank Hardy, and Alexander Elliot as Joe Hardy takes place in Bridgeport.

On Thursday, three Port Hope Police cruisers were blocking the entrances to the filming area.

Downtown Port Hope is turning into Bridgeport temporarily as a number of emergency vehicles lined the streets of Queen Street and Demon Day banners were hung over Walton Street and at least one float promoting the Demon Queen were along the street.

The street closure takes place until Friday, August 27, at 2 a.m.
